[Judah confronts Esther and Malluch in the Valley of the Lepers]

Judah Ben-Hur:
[angrily, to Esther]
Why did you tell me they were dead?
Esther:
It was what they wanted. Judah, I must not betray this faith. Will you do this for them?
Judah Ben-Hur:
Not to see them?
Esther:
[seeing Miriam and Tirzah approach]
They are coming... Judah! Judah, love them in the way they most need to be loved: not to look at them! Judah, let it be as though you had never come here. Please, Judah!
[Judah hides behind a boulder as Esther goes to meet Miriam]

Miriam:
Is Judah well? Is he happy?
[Judah's face twists in anguish]

Esther:
Yes. He is well. Your mind can be at rest for him. He is well, Miriam.
Miriam:
[taking the basket of food]
God be with you.
[Miriam and Tirzah go back into their cave]

Esther:
[going back to Judah]
They are gone. We can go back.
Judah Ben-Hur:
[bitterly]
Go back... to what?
Esther:
Judah, they have one blessing left: to think you remember them as they were. Live your own life. Forget what is here.
Judah Ben-Hur:
Forget? It's as if they were alive in a grave!
Esther:
But what can you do?
Judah Ben-Hur:
Undo what you've done! How could you have suffered them to come here? I must see them!
Esther:
No Judah, please! Judah!
[Judah starts toward the cave but is stopped by Malluch]

Esther:
Oh, think, Judah, *think*! It will tear them apart if they see you!
